Commit Graph

767 Commits

Author SHA1 Message Date
bergware a59cc208ee Docker: add route for remote WireGuard access
Containers with network 'br0' can be remotely accessed by WireGuard without the need to configure static router on the home router (gateway)

"Host access to custom networks" must be enabled to allow access
2022-04-17 22:56:48 +02:00
bergware 50019fa215 Docker: fixed header display causes gap 2022-04-11 14:16:27 +02:00
bergware 10fdad645d Docker: fixed list display in fixed view mode 2022-04-11 13:46:52 +02:00
bergware c696d0eded Docker settings: suppress browser presets 2022-04-11 00:49:16 +02:00
Squidly271 d520342dfb Update CreateDocker.php 2022-04-06 18:05:37 -04:00
Squidly271 0b31bba645 Docker: Silence PHP errors when editing a template if corruption exists 2022-04-06 18:02:21 -04:00
bergware 0d9c923fad Use https for internet connectivity check 2022-03-17 11:09:06 +01:00
bergware 7b8f99ba09 Docker: make popup window fit in browser window 2022-03-12 21:20:43 +01:00
Squidly271 e40e3fe9ff Docker: Add Network / Privacy Category 2022-03-10 14:08:24 -05:00
bergware 6753e1c6d0 jQuery scripts version updates 2022-03-03 19:28:14 +01:00
bergware 7cbb9bb8ec Fixed: spinner stays visible after docker command 2022-02-24 19:15:12 +01:00
tom mortensen 054e2006f8 Merge pull request #1024 from Squidly271/patch-35
Docker: Handle edge case involving browser back button when within CA…
2022-02-16 16:18:47 -08:00
Squidly271 978b5ee8eb Docker: Handle edge case involving browser back button when within CA in certain unlikely circumstances 2022-02-05 13:09:08 -05:00
shayne d57affd193 Always show "WebUI" for user specified URLs
I often specify custom WebUI URLs based on my network/local-domain
setup. I rarely if ever use "http://[IP]:[PORT:8888]/" templated URLs.

This change maintains support for the existing templated
bridged/host-network URL schema while enabling the "WebUI" affordance
for containers where the user explicitly entered a WebUI url, e.g.
"https://grafana.mylan.io"
2022-02-03 10:24:20 -05:00
bergware fd7395deb1 Docker: fix GUI may hang when multiple screens are opened 2022-01-21 13:18:48 +01:00
bergware 44f2e8ffad Revert "Docker: check for existence before removing container or image"
This reverts commit 4b773ad1c8.
2022-01-21 11:36:50 +01:00
bergware 4b773ad1c8 Docker: check for existence before removing container or image 2022-01-21 10:39:36 +01:00
bergware dfb7b0d7b2 Bug fixes 2022-01-20 10:02:02 +01:00
bergware 65af74e84f Nchan: simplified error reporting 2022-01-18 13:37:37 +01:00
bergware 91fc883538 Nchan fix regression errors 2022-01-17 21:15:41 +01:00
tom mortensen 4d791ab81d Merge pull request #1004 from Squidly271/master
Docker: Don't update installed user templates
2022-01-17 08:17:16 -08:00
tom mortensen ee4aa36516 Merge pull request #1005 from bergware/master
Nchan improvements
2022-01-17 08:16:51 -08:00
bergware a18bce229b Nchan improvements
Use multiplexed channels and add error reporting
2022-01-17 12:54:22 +01:00
Squidly271 0e50d4eb63 Don't update templates 2022-01-16 16:25:09 -05:00
Squidly271 36f02bd391 Revert https://github.com/limetech/webgui/pull/1003 2022-01-16 16:22:38 -05:00
Squidly271 4e404d5212 Update CreateDocker.php 2022-01-16 07:47:53 -05:00
bergware b8401076d8 Expand ipaddr() with protocol; selection
protocol defaults to ipv4 in case of ipv4 + ipv6
2022-01-15 12:49:32 +01:00
bergware e694417775 Docker: log window at all times 2021-12-30 19:42:08 +01:00
bergware 28792e2ba8 Updates to openterminal implementation 2021-12-30 17:28:38 +01:00
bergware 52c144cbd8 Docker: update window uses color of selected theme 2021-12-23 16:02:17 +01:00
bergware 8bfd03a470 Docker: update window uses color of selected theme 2021-12-23 15:59:19 +01:00
bergware 7c5a45b86b Docker: update window uses color of selected theme 2021-12-23 15:56:43 +01:00
bergware 9b40609e72 Docker: remove close button in popup windiow 2021-12-23 14:00:37 +01:00
bergware a36da73f2e Open windows with dynamic size and minimum size 2021-12-23 13:52:39 +01:00
bergware 7eccff3219 Open windows with dynamic size and minimum size 2021-12-22 17:27:51 +01:00
bergware f74bfc7c61 Open docker window with dynamic size 2021-12-22 14:59:54 +01:00
bergware cef100b931 Docker: optimized contextmenu 2021-12-21 00:42:04 +01:00
bergware cece662c1e Disable spellcheck on text input 2021-12-20 21:55:53 +01:00
bergware 73ecaf6e24 Fixed URI encoding 2021-12-18 17:08:12 +01:00
bergware 5d6122d983 Minor visual update 2021-12-03 18:13:51 +01:00
bergware bea5f40d2d Updated bitstream font to support more languages 2021-12-03 17:59:35 +01:00
bergware 5fb3c4d400 Docker: minor menu update 2021-11-15 12:44:04 +01:00
bergware a8ec3702af Docker: minor menu update 2021-11-15 12:40:26 +01:00
bergware 9beb8895f4 Docker: fix regression error 2021-11-15 12:32:48 +01:00
bergware a3da1524ad Docker: fix regression error 2021-11-15 12:28:25 +01:00
tom mortensen 35f5647c38 Merge pull request #980 from bergware/master
Miscellaneous updates and fixes
2021-11-11 09:28:08 -08:00
bergware 54465f287c Update docker.js 2021-11-11 04:20:53 +01:00
bergware b18cef0219 Replace openWindow() for openTerminal()
Use ttyd for logging windows
2021-11-11 02:44:35 +01:00
Squidly271 c9ed2ecf39 Update DockerClient.php 2021-11-06 19:10:21 -04:00
Andrew Z 3054d31db1 I hate spaces :) 2021-11-06 17:10:53 -04:00